II. Historical Evolution of Advertising
A. Early Forms of Advertising
Advertising, in various types, has actually been an essential part of human history given that ancient times. Early civilizations used basic techniques to promote products and services, leveraging basic communication techniques to reach potential consumers. Some early forms of advertising consist of:
- Pictorial Signage: In ancient markets, traders used pictorial indications and symbols to recognize their shops and show the items they provided. These visual cues worked as an early form of branding and helped illiterate people acknowledge organizations.
- Town Criers: In medieval Europe, town criers played an essential function in sharing information and advertising events. They would openly reveal news, pronouncements, and commercial messages, serving as human "loudspeakers" for organizations and authorities.
- Handbills and Posters: In the 17th and 18th centuries, printed handbills and posters became popular advertising tools. These advertising materials were plastered on walls, trees, and other public areas to notify the local neighborhood about items, services, and occasions.
B. The Birth of Modern Advertising
The Industrial Revolution in the 19th century produced significant modifications to the advertising landscape. Advancements in technology and mass production, paired with the growth of urban centers, developed brand-new opportunities for businesses to reach larger audiences. Secret turning points in the birth of modern advertising consist of:
- Newspapers and Magazines: With the rise of industrialization and the printing press, papers and publications emerged as popular advertising platforms. Organizations began placing paid advertisements in publications, targeting particular demographics based on readership.
- Branding and Logos: As competitors increased, businesses acknowledged the requirement for distinction. They began embracing logo designs and slogans to establish brand name identities that customers might acknowledge and trust.
- Advertising Agencies: In the late 19th century, the very first ad agency were developed, marking a shift from private companies managing their promos to customized companies offering advertising services. These agencies brought a more tactical and imaginative approach to advertising.

Online Banner Ads
Online banner ads are among the earliest and most recognizable kinds of digital advertising. These visual ads are shown on sites, normally at the top, bottom, or sides of a page. Banner advertisements can be fixed images, animated gifs, or even interactive multimedia elements. They aim to get the attention of site visitors and direct them to the marketer's website or landing page. The success of banner advertisements counts on engaging visuals, appealing copy, and tactical advertisement positioning on pertinent websites.
Social Media Advertising
The rise of social media platforms has actually changed how companies reach their target market. Social media advertising involves developing and promoting advertisements on popular socials media such as Facebook, Instagram, Twitter, LinkedIn, and others. These platforms use advanced targeting options based on demographics, interests, habits, and even custom-made audience sectors. Social media advertisements can take numerous formats, consisting of image advertisements, video advertisements, carousel advertisements, and sponsored posts. The interactive and extremely appealing nature of social networks ads permits brand names to develop strong connections with their audience and drive conversions.
Online Search Engine Marketing (SEM)
Search Engine Marketing (SEM) is a form of paid advertising that intends to increase a website's visibility on online search engine results pages (SERPs). It involves bidding on specific keywords relevant to business, and when users search for those keywords, the advertisements appear on top or bottom of the search engine result. SEM can be highly reliable as it targets users actively looking for product and services related to the advertiser's offerings. Google Ads (formerly called Google AdWords) is the most popular platform for SEM, however other online search engine like Bing also provide comparable advertising chances.
